All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/somerset/ _______________________________________________ YODER Gilda May Yoder, 71, of 388 Sunny Vale Rd., Meyersdale, died Nov. 28, 1999, at her residence. Born Nov. 3, 1928, in Coal Run, Pa., she was a daughter of the late Jerry and Alverta (Stevanus) Stevanus. She was also preceded in death by two husbands David T. Yoder, July 22, 1963 and Albert R. Yoder, March 1, 1996: two sons, Donald L. Yoder and an infant; one granddaughter, Laura Peck; one sister, Mabel Stevanus; and one brother, Dewey Stevanus. Survived by five daughters, Mrs. Bradley (Penny) Mason, Mrs. David (Patricia) Knopsnyder, Mrs. Steven (Tammy) Hoover, all of Meyersdale; Mrs. Steven (Teresa) Trau, Margate, Fla., and Mrs. Scott (Roberta) Peck, Fort Hill, Pa.; two brothers, Clifford J. Stevanus, Somerset, and Martin W. Stevanus, Confluence; 14 grandchildren and 8 great-grandchildren. Member of Salisbury Church of the Brethren. She was a homemaker. Friends will be received from 2-4 and 7-9 p.m., Monday at the Newman Funeral Homes, P.A., Grantsville, Md., where services will be conducted at 2 p.m., Tuesday, with the Rev. Daniel J. Whitacre officiating. Interment, Salisbury Cemetery. Pallbearers will be Richard, David and John Mason, Barry Jacobs, Dan Haines and David Knopsnyder Jr. Expressions of sympathy may be directed to either Salisbury Church of the Brethren or Somerset "In Touch" Hospice. Daily American, November 29, 1999
